1804 and 1806 motors are good for 5" Prop and it may cause overheat if you run it with 6" prop. So you need this H2206.

Specification
Model: H2206-6
KV: 1950KV
Weight: Approx. 32g (net weight included long AWG cables)
Prop Shaft Diameter: 5mm(no prop adapter is required for most 5mm props)
Clockwise Screw Thread
Stator Diameter: 22mm
Stator Length: 6mm
Shaft Diameter: 3mm
Motor Dimensions: Φ27*18mm
Configuration: 12N14P
ldle Current: 0.74A @ 10V
Internal Resistance: 0.1Ω
Suitable ESC: 8-20A (depends on the prop you use)
HobbyWing's XRotor works pretty well with H2206 motor so it is recommended especially the XRotor 20A is small in size as small as some 10A-12A ESC.
Since SimonK and BLHeli might shutter during high RPM on small props (eg. 5030). So if you plan to drive the motor hard, please consider to get XRotor 20A or 40A because XRotor was tested at high RPM without any sync issue.
Suitable Battery: 2-4S Li-Po (refer to thrust test table and videos)
